相关文章
用JAVA实现人工智能:采用框架Spring AI Java
Spring AI 集成人工智能,为Java项目添加AI功能指南
本文主旨是用实际的可操作的代码,介绍Java怎么通过spring ai 接入大模型。
例子使用spring ai alibaba QWen千问api完成,你可以跑通以后换自己的实现。QWen目前有100万免费Token额度&…
建站知识
2025/1/11 0:47:31
网络安全:守护数字世界的防线
在信息化时代,网络已成为人们生活和工作的基础设施,从在线购物、社交互动到企业运营、政府服务,无处不在的网络连接着全球各地的人们和组织。然而,网络的便捷性也带来了诸多安全风险,网络安全问题日益凸显,…
建站知识
2025/1/11 0:46:31
window.open 被浏览器拦截解决方案
前言
在项目开发中,点击支付按钮后需要发送支付请求,并在请求完成后的回调中,经过一系列判断,符合某种条件下弹出一个新窗口页面。自然想到使用 window.open,但发现该操作会被浏览器拦截。
分析原因
当浏览器检测到…
建站知识
2025/1/11 0:45:30
Unity Burst详解
【简介】
Burst是Unity的编译优化技术,优化了从C#代码编译成Native代码的过程,经过编译优化后代码有更高的运行效率。
在Unity中使用Burst很简单,在方法或类前加上[BurstCompile]特性即可。在构建时编译代码的步骤,Burst编译器会…
建站知识
2025/1/11 0:44:28
redis cluster集群安装部署
这里是本地虚拟机演示cluster集群部署,所以直接安装了6个节点,模拟的是3个服务器,每台服务器安装2个redis进程,6个redis组成集群。
(1)环境准备
Linux操作系统、redis5.0.2.tar.gz
确认操作系统中安装gc…
建站知识
2025/1/11 0:43:26
企业级PHP异步RabbitMQ协程版客户端 2.0 正式发布
概述
workerman/rabbitmq 是一个异步RabbitMQ客户端,使用AMQP协议。
RabbitMQ是一个基于AMQP(高级消息队列协议)实现的开源消息组件,它主要用于在分布式系统中存储和转发消息。RabbitMQ由高性能、高可用以及高扩展性出名的Erlan…
建站知识
2025/1/11 0:42:24
设计模式 行为型 中介者模式(Mediator Pattern)与 常见技术框架应用 解析
中介者模式(Mediator Pattern)是一种行为型设计模式,旨在通过引入一个中介者对象来协调各个对象之间的交互,从而避免它们之间直接相互通信。
一、核心思想
中介者模式(Mediator Pattern)核心思想是将对象…
建站知识
2025/1/11 0:41:22
k8s的ip地址分别都是从哪里来的
节点(Node)IP 地址 物理网络分配:如果 Kubernetes 集群是部署在企业内部数据中心的物理服务器上,节点 IP 通常是由企业内部的网络管理员通过 DHCP(动态主机配置协议)或者静态分配的方式确定的。例如&#x…
建站知识
2025/1/11 0:40:21